Demko doesnt get you a top 10 pick. I feel like a lot of people have unrealistic expectations of goalie trades due to Schnieder. But that was a huge outlyer. No other goalie has gotten as much in a trade since. That was after him putting up two seasons of .930 goaltending. Demko looks promising, but is around .915.
Goalies just dont have trade value, with the volatility and the number available in free agency. If we trade him we maybe get a 2nd.
